编程老师的理解与认识是什么

worktile 其他 14

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程老师是指在教育机构或学校从事编程教学工作的专业人士。他们通过教授编程语言、编程思维和编程技术等知识,培养学生的计算机编程能力和创新思维。编程老师的理解与认识主要包括以下几个方面:

    1. 知识储备:编程老师需要具备扎实的计算机科学和编程知识。他们熟悉各种编程语言、开发工具和编程技术,并能够灵活运用这些知识进行教学。同时,他们也需要不断学习和更新自己的知识,跟上技术的发展和变化。

    2. 教学能力:编程老师需要具备良好的教学能力。他们能够将抽象的编程概念和技术转化为简单易懂的语言,让学生能够理解和掌握。他们善于启发学生的思考和创造,培养学生的问题解决能力和团队合作精神。

    3. 实践经验:编程老师通常需要具备一定的实践经验。他们可能有过软件开发、项目管理或者研究等方面的工作经历,能够将自己的实践经验融入到教学中,让学生能够更好地理解和应用知识。

    4. 激发兴趣:编程老师需要激发学生对编程的兴趣和热爱。他们能够通过生动的案例和实例,展示编程在现实生活中的应用和价值,让学生产生兴趣并主动参与到学习中来。

    5. 个人素质:编程老师需要具备良好的沟通能力、团队合作能力和适应能力。他们能够与学生和家长建立良好的关系,及时反馈学生的学习情况,并与其他教师进行合作,共同提升教学质量。

    综上所述,编程老师的理解与认识包括扎实的知识储备、良好的教学能力、丰富的实践经验、激发学生兴趣和良好的个人素质。他们通过教学工作,为学生提供了学习编程的机会和平台,培养了他们的计算机编程能力和创新思维,为他们的未来发展奠定了基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程老师是指在教育机构或者培训机构从事编程教学工作的人员。他们具备深厚的编程知识和技能,能够教授学生编程的基本概念、语法和算法等内容,引导学生解决实际问题和开发应用程序。编程老师的理解与认识主要包括以下几个方面:

    1.专业知识与技能:编程老师必须具备扎实的编程知识和技能,包括掌握多种编程语言、熟悉开发工具和环境、了解软件开发流程等。他们需要不断学习和更新自己的知识,以适应快速发展的编程领域。

    2.教学能力:编程老师需要具备良好的教学能力,包括清晰的表达能力、耐心的教导态度和灵活的教学方法。他们要能够将复杂的编程概念和技术以简单易懂的方式传授给学生,引导学生理解和掌握编程思维和逻辑。

    3.实践经验:编程老师通常需要有一定的实践经验,能够将理论知识与实际应用相结合。他们可能在编程项目中有过实际的开发经验,能够分享自己的经验和教学案例,帮助学生理解编程的实际应用场景。

    4.激发学生兴趣:编程老师需要具备激发学生兴趣的能力,通过生动有趣的教学方式和实例,引导学生对编程产生兴趣和热情。他们可以组织编程竞赛、项目实践等活动,让学生体验到编程的乐趣和成就感。

    5.关注学生发展:编程老师不仅仅是传授知识,更重要的是关注学生的发展。他们需要了解学生的学习需求和能力水平,因材施教,给予个性化的指导和辅导。同时,他们还可以帮助学生规划职业发展路径,提供就业指导和资源支持。

    总之,编程老师是具备专业知识、教学能力和实践经验的教育工作者,他们的理解与认识涵盖了编程知识和技能、教学能力、实践经验、激发学生兴趣和关注学生发展等多个方面。他们的工作旨在培养学生的编程能力和创新思维,为他们的未来发展打下坚实的基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程老师是指专门教授编程知识和技能的教师。他们在教育领域中扮演着重要的角色,培养学生的编程思维、解决问题的能力和创新能力。编程老师应该具备以下几个方面的理解与认识:

    1. 理解编程的重要性:编程是现代社会中一项非常重要的技能。编程可以帮助人们解决问题、提高效率、创造价值。编程老师应该清楚地认识到编程的重要性,并将其传达给学生。

    2. 理解编程的本质:编程是一种将思想转化为计算机可执行指令的过程。编程老师应该深入理解编程的基本原理和概念,包括数据结构、算法、面向对象等,以便能够将这些知识传授给学生。

    3. 理解学生的需求:编程老师需要理解学生的学习需求和水平。不同年龄段、不同背景的学生对编程的理解和学习方式有所不同。编程老师应该根据学生的特点和需求,灵活调整教学内容和方法。

    4. 理解教学方法和策略:编程老师应该掌握有效的教学方法和策略。例如,通过实践项目来激发学生的兴趣和动力,通过编程挑战来培养学生的解决问题的能力。编程老师还应该关注学生的学习进度和反馈,及时调整教学计划。

    5. 理解行业趋势和技术发展:编程老师需要不断更新自己的知识和技能,了解行业的最新动态和技术发展。他们应该知道哪些编程语言和工具当前比较热门,哪些技术有较高的就业前景,以便能够向学生提供准确的指导和建议。

    总之,编程老师应该具备深入理解编程的重要性和本质的认识,了解学生的需求,掌握有效的教学方法和策略,关注行业趋势和技术发展。通过不断学习和提升自己的能力,他们能够更好地教授编程知识,培养学生的编程能力和创新思维,为学生的未来发展做出贡献。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部